Rondo is accelerating industry’s transition to lower-cost, zero-carbon heat and power.

Our Rondo Heat Batteries turn low-cost renewable electricity into continuous, high-temperature heat and power, enabling industrial facilities to replace fossil-fired boilers without costly process changes. The result is lower-cost,zero-carbon industrial energy delivered safely, reliably, and at 98% efficiency.

Rondo is commercially deployed and rapidlyscaling,today. Backed by world-class industrial leaders and investors — including Breakthrough Energy, Energy Impact Partners, Rio Tinto, Aramco, SABIC, SCG, TITAN, Microsoft, H&M, and John Doerr — Rondo is building the next generation of industrial energyinfrastructure atglobal scale.
